Job Description

You will be part of the team that supports Procurement and Inventory for the Group. Majority of your responsibilities will involve managing a spectrum of procurement process for direct and indirect material, as well as maintaining inventory levels.

Vendor Management:

  • Develop and maintain relationships with key vendors to ensure reliable and cost-effective supply chain partnerships.
  • Negotiate supplier contracts, terms, and conditions to achieve favorable agreements for the organization.

Inventory Management:

  • Monitor inventory levels and work with the inventory team to ensure optimal stock levels are maintained.
  • Implement inventory control strategies to minimize waste and excess inventory.
  • Assist in the development of inventory forecasts and demand planning.
  • Assist in Annual Inventory Stock Count

Cost Analysis:

  • Analyze procurement data and cost structures to identify cost-saving opportunities.
  • Assist in budget management, tracking expenses, and ensuring procurement activities remain within budgetary constraints

Compliance and Risk Management:

  • Ensure compliance with procurement policies, laws, and regulations.
  • Identify and mitigate procurement-related risks.
  • Assist in conducting supplier audits to ensure adherence to quality and compliance standards.

Reporting and Documentation:

  • Prepare reports on procurement activities, including supplier performance, cost savings, and inventory levels.
  • Maintain accurate records of procurement transactions, contracts, and correspondence.

Cross-Functional Collaboration:

  • Collaborate with other departments, such as finance, operations, and logistics, to ensure seamless procurement operations.
  • Work with internal stakeholders to understand their procurement needs and provide procurement support accordingly.
